The administration of ‘Amanoor’ dismissed the secretary general of the union’s union office. Following this dismissal, the unions of Tangier, members of the Regional Union, met in the administration of the Union where they called on all activists to participate, overwhelmingly, in all the protests to be organized by the Moroccan Labor Union (UMT).
The dismissal of the union leader caused a large revolt in the company especially that the director of the company, Jean Luc Roudier, dismissed Abdelatif Arazi without any reason or any notice.
The employees of 'Amanoor' considered that the dismissal in question is a serious decision which is a provocation of the Moroccan authorities since the governor of the region intervened to manage the wage crisis and managed to end it by forcing the company to comply with the Moroccan Labor Code.
The director of ‘Amanoor’ was appointed to his post just two years ago and that his management of the company has always been a source of tension.
